Chapter 8: Configuring Switches for Stacking
Step
4
Check the running configuration of the master switch with the SHOW RUNNING-
CONFIG command for the following commands:
- Four STACK commands.
- Two SWITCH PROVISION commands, with the IDs 1 and 2.
- INTERFACE and STACKPORT commands designating the ports of the stack trunk
for both the provisioned master switch (port1) and the member switch (port2). The
stacking ports here are only an example. Your stacking ports might be different.
awplus# show running-config
.
stack virtual-mac
stack virtual-chassis-id 115
stack enable
stack 1 priority 1
.
switch 1 provision x950-28
switch 2 provision x950-28
.
interface port1.0.33-1.0.37
stackport
.
interface port2.0.33-2.0.37
stackport

What to Do Next

134
Table 17. Verifying the Master Switch (Continued)
Description and Command
After configuring the master switch, do the following:
1. Power off the switch by disconnecting its AC power cords from the AC
power sources. Refer to Figure 79 on page 134.
